    The ZTE MF910 (also known as the Megafon MR150-2) is a popular but aging 4G mobile hotspot. While it's generally stable, enthusiasts often look for firmware updates to unlock additional bands, fix TTL (to bypass hotspot data limits), or change the IMEI. Why Update Your Firmware?

    Carrier Unlocking: Many MF910 units are carrier-locked. Updating to a generic or "Telia" firmware can remove these restrictions.

    Frequency Locking: Unlike many cheap routers, the MF910 firmware allows you to lock the device to a specific frequency (Bands) directly through the web GUI without hacking.

    TTL Fixes: Custom firmware allows for TTL (Time to Live) modifications, which helps in avoiding "hotspot tethering" detection by mobile carriers.

    Stability: Some early firmwares have issues with usb_modeswitch causing crashes; specific firmware scripts can fix these "mode" switching errors. Where to Find Firmware & Tools

    Official updates from ZTE are rare, so the community relies on repositories and forums:

    4PDA Forum: This is the most comprehensive resource for MF910 firmware. It includes instructions for flashing the popular Telia09 firmware and tools for changing IMEI and TTL.

    GitHub (kristrev): Offers scripts to "make the MF910 play nice," including scripts to disable Wi-Fi or manage modem modes via the terminal. Security Warning

    Recent security audits (presented at Defcon) revealed that the MF910 is "end-of-life" and contains numerous hidden debug calls and unpatched vulnerabilities. While it's great for reversing and "messing around," avoid using it for handling sensitive data without additional security layers. Common Troubleshooting

    There are two primary ways to update your device: through the web user interface (WebUI) or by manually flashing a stock ROM. Method 1: Online Update via WebUI The simplest way to update your is through the official administration page.

    Connect to the Device: Link your laptop or phone to the MF910's Wi-Fi network.

    Access the Admin Page: Open a web browser and enter http://192.168.0.1 or http://setup.zte.

    Log In: Use the default password, which is typically admin, unless you have changed it.

    Navigate to Updates: Go to Settings > Device Settings > Software Update.

    Check for Updates: Click Check to see if a new version is available. Ensure the device is in a Connected state to download the files.

    Install: If an update is found, follow the on-screen prompts to download and install it. Method 2: Manual Flashing (Stock ROM)

    There are three primary ways to handle updates for this specific model: 1. The "One-Click" Internal UpdateMost units have a built-in update tool. Connect your laptop to the hotspot's Wi-Fi. Navigate to the Admin Page (usually 192.168.0.1). Log in with your password (default is often admin).

    Go to Settings > Device Settings > Update to check for over-the-air (OTA) versions.

    2. Manual Flashing (For Advanced Users)If you have a branded device (like Vodafone) and want to use it with other carriers, you might need to flash "debranded" firmware.

    GitHub Resources: Developers on GitHub have created scripts to push patches and reconnect tools to the device. SSH Access: You can actually SSH into the

    using the username root and the password zte9x15 to manually modify system files.
